Electric vehicle backrest with armrests
By designing a U-shaped stainless steel handrail and a retractable extension rod on the back of the electric vehicle, the problem of the lack of handrails on the back of the electric vehicle is solved, improving the safety and comfort of the rear passengers.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of electric vehicle accessories technology, and relates to an electric vehicle backrest with armrests. Background Technology
[0002] Electric vehicles are currently a widely used mode of transportation, bringing great convenience to people's lives. The electric vehicle backrest is one of the important components of an electric vehicle. Installed at the rear of the electric vehicle, it provides support for passengers when the vehicle is carrying people.
[0003] However, the current design of electric vehicle backrests without armrests means that passengers in the back seat can only hold onto the driver's clothing. This affects both the driver's riding experience and the safety of the passengers in the back seat. Therefore, we have designed an electric vehicle backrest with armrests to solve the above technical problems. Summary of the Invention
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to provide an electric vehicle backrest with armrests to solve the problems mentioned in the background art.
[0005] The purpose of this utility model can be achieved through the following technical solution: an electric vehicle backrest with a handrail, including a U-shaped stainless steel handrail, a support rod fixedly installed at the center of the top of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ail, a backrest fixedly installed at the top of the support rod, and retractable extension rods provided at both ends of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ail.
[0006] In the above-mentioned electric vehicle backrest with armrest, the two ends of the U-shaped stainless steel armrest are fixed with an integral mounting block, and the center of the two mounting blocks is provided with a mounting screw hole. The two mounting blocks are fixedly connected to the electric vehicle frame by bolts.
[0007] In the aforementioned electric vehicle backrest with armrest, slots are provided at both ends of the U-shaped stainless steel armrest, and the extension rod is inserted into the slot. A limiting block is fixed at the end of the extension rod inside the slot.
[0008] In the aforementioned electric vehicle backrest with armrests, the surface of the extension rod is provided with multiple threaded holes at equal intervals.
[0009] In the aforementioned electric vehicle backrest with armrests, locking bolts are threaded to both sides of the U-shaped stainless steel armrest, and the locking bolts are threaded to the corresponding threaded holes.
[0010] In the aforementioned electric vehicle backrest with armrests, the interior of the backrest is filled with sponge blocks.
[0011] Compared with the prior art, the advantages of the electric vehicle backrest with handrail of this utility model are as follows: the electric vehicle backrest is equipped with a U-shaped stainless steel handrail, which improves the stability of the passenger sitting or lying down during the electric vehicle's operation, thereby improving the safety of carrying passengers on the electric vehicle. [0015] In the diagram, 1. U-shaped stainless steel handrail; 2. Support rod; 3. Backrest; 4. Extension rod; 5. Mounting block; 6. Mounting screw hole; 7. Locking bolt; 8. Threaded hole; 9. Limiting block. Detailed Implementation
[0016] The following are specific embodiments of the present invention, which are described in conjunction with the accompanying drawings. However, the present invention is not limited to these embodiments.
[0017] like Figure 1-3 As shown, the present invention provides an electric vehicle backrest with a handrail, including a U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1, a support rod 2 fixedly installed at the center of the top of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1, a backrest 3 fixedly installed at the top of the support rod 2, and retractable extension rods 4 provided at both ends of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1.
[0018] Specifically, the electric vehicle backrest 3, through the setting of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1, allows pedestrians in the rear seat to improve the stability of sitting or lying down during the electric vehicle's operation, thereby improving the safety of carrying passengers on the electric vehicle.
[0019]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 3 As shown, this utility model discloses an electric vehicle backrest with a handrail. The two ends of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 are fixed with an integral mounting block 5. The center of each mounting block 5 is provided with a mounting screw hole 6. The two mounting blocks 5 are fixedly connected to the electric vehicle frame by bolts.
[0020] The U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 has slots at both ends, and the extension rod 4 is inserted into the slot. A limit block 9 is fixed at the end of the extension rod 4 inside the slot.
[0021] Specifically, the setting of the limiting block 9 prevents the extension rod 4 from separating from the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1.
[0022] Multiple threaded holes 8 are equidistantly opened on the surface of the extension rod 4.
[0023] The U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 has locking bolts 7 threadedly connected to both sides of the corners, and the locking bolts 7 are threadedly connected to the corresponding threaded holes 8.
[0024] Specifically, the extension rod 4 can be easily fixed inside the slot by the cooperation of the locking bolt 7 and the threaded hole 8.
[0025] The backrest 3 is filled with foam blocks. Specifically, the foam blocks inside the backrest 3 improve the softness of the backrest.
[0026] In specific implementation, when using the electric vehicle backrest, the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 with the backrest 3 is first fixedly assembled to the electric vehicle frame with fixing bolts. When the electric vehicle is being ridden, the pedestrian in the back seat can improve the stability of sitting or lying down through the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1, thereby improving the safety of carrying people on the electric vehicle. At the same time, both ends of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 are equipped with extension rods 4, and the extension rods 4 are fixed to the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 with locking bolts 7. The length of the U-shaped stainless steel handrail 1 can be adjusted according to needs to ensure the convenience of gripping for the person in the back seat.
